Bruges
Music Scene
- Charlie Rockets
- A café with a difference, Charlie Rockets has a youth hostel upstairs & is known for its vibrant cultural mix – as well as its regular live music performances.

- Concertgebouw (Concert Hall)
- Famed for both its bold red design & its fusion of classical music & dance under one roof, it puts on over 100 performances of dance & music each year.

- Nocturne Bar
- Go down these stairs & you'll walk into one Bruges' oldest cellars, transformed into a beautiful bar where you can enjoy a drink and regular live music performances.

- 't Zwart Huis
- Classy jazz, blues & soul to complement its menu of classic dishes, the 'Black House Bistro' is a late-Gothic townhouse with a truly unique atmosphere.
